Monorepo Management
Build efficient, scalable monorepos that enable code sharing, consistent tooling, and atomic changes across multiple packages and applications.
Use this skill when
- Setting up new monorepo projects
- Migrating from multi-repo to monorepo
- Optimizing build and test performance
- Managing shared dependencies
- Implementing code sharing strategies
- Setting up CI/CD for monorepos
- Versioning and publishing packages
- Debugging monorepo-specific issues
